Who among the following rulers of medieval Gujarat surrendered Diu to Portuguese?
- AAhmad Shah
- BMahmud Begarha
- CBahadur ShahCorrect
- DMuhammad Shah
Explanation
Bahadur Shah was the Sultan of Gujarat who had significant interactions and conflicts with the Portuguese in the early 16th century. Facing pressure from the growing Mughal Empire under Humayun, Bahadur Shah sought assistance from the Portuguese. In 1534, he signed the Treaty of Bassein with the Portuguese, ceding the island of Bassein and its dependencies to them and promising to give them Diu. Later, he was killed by the Portuguese in 1537 during negotiations concerning the fort of Diu. This event eventually led to the Portuguese gaining complete control over Diu.
